RECORD SHOOTING.
FINE ARTILLERY PRACTICE.
telegraph, Presa A»s’n, Copyright Received 9.45 p.m., April 5. Sydney, April 5. No. 2 company of Australian Artillery, practising at the three thousand eight hundred aud four thousand eight hundred yard ranges, made nine direct hits out of ten shots in four minnteß uuder the time allowance, which is believed to be reoord.
